The Mukhyamantri Mahila Samman Yojana is a scheme introduced by the Delhi government as part of its 2024 budget. This initiative is designed to financially empower women by providing them with a direct benefit of ₹1,000 per month deposited directly into their bank accounts.
The scheme is designed to help women, especially those from economically weaker backgrounds, by providing them a steady income to cover their basic needs and become more financially independent. It reflects the government’s effort to promote gender equality and support women in society.
Only women aged 18 and above are eligible to receive the benefits of this scheme. The money is directly transferred to their bank accounts, ensuring there are no middlemen, and making the process simple and transparent.
Aam Aadmi Party chief Arvind Kejriwal also announced that the monthly assistance of ₹1,000 under the scheme would be increased to ₹2,100 if the AAP is re-elected in the upcoming Assembly elections.

Mukhyamantri Mahila Samman Yojana Eligibility Criteria
Here are the eligibility criteria for the Delhi Government’s Mukhyamantri Mahila Samman Yojana.
- Applicants must be permanent residents of Delhi.
- Women must be 18 years or older to qualify.
- Annual family income must not exceed ₹3 lakh.
- Cannot be a government employee or a taxpayer.
- Applicants receiving government pensions are not eligible.
Documents Required
You need to have these documents before applying for the Mukhyamantri Mahila Samman Yojana:
- Aadhaar Card
- Voter ID
- PAN Card
- Bank Account Details
- Income Certificate
- Address Proof: Accepted documents include an electricity bill, water bill, or ration card.
- Age Proof: Accepted documents include a birth certificate, school leaving certificate, or passport.
- Self-Declaration: A document in which the applicant confirms that they meet the eligibility criteria of the scheme.
How to Apply for the Delhi Mukhyamantri Mahila Samman Scheme?
The Delhi Mahila Samman Yojana apply online process has not been opened yet; the application process is currently offline. The Mukhyamantri Mahila Samman Yojana form can be downloaded from the Delhi government’s official website. Follow the step-by-step process outlined below:
- You can download the application form from the official Delhi government website.
- Complete the form and submit it with the required documents at the nearest office.
- The government will review your application for eligibility.
- Authorities will verify the information provided in the form.
- Once approved, a notification will be sent to inform you of your eligibility for the scheme benefits.
Note: Those who are government employees, taxpayers, pensioners, or already receiving government benefits are not eligible for the scheme in Delhi.
